Output 8596d2c3f6df5a7a873d2cd2d1a16dc99a52c454f92cb9863c089766dab2a52d:1

value
1004053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7cbb5c541de6dc892376874e9b311dcbc76198a OP_EQUALVERIFY OP_CHECKSIG
address
1KDRWCNWfpN6Znfx4mXYzkgAhBASJUijqE
transaction
8596d2c3f6df5a7a873d2cd2d1a16dc99a52c454f92cb9863c089766dab2a52d
spent
true